      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Is it possible to share a non-spatial stand-alone table that is not related to any feature?&amp;nbsp; I can publish the service with the table as long as there is a feature in the mxd, but just the table looks like is not possible (share as option is grey out).&amp;nbsp; The idea is to later use the data in a operational dashboard, but is not identified as external data, just the feature layers.&amp;nbsp; In other words, is it possible to use a stand alone table (no relations or joins) in the dashboard?&amp;nbsp; I'm using 10.2.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;thanks&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i Ulises,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I did test the workflow suggested in my link above.&amp;nbsp; It is easy to publish standalone tables to be used in an operations dashboard.&amp;nbsp; &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;1.&amp;nbsp; Add the tables to ArcMap along with a feature class.&amp;nbsp; I wasn't able to publish just the tables without the feature class.&amp;nbsp; I think there are other discussion out there about this issue.&amp;nbsp; But once the feature class was added to the map then the "Share as service" option was active.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;2.&amp;nbsp; Publish the service&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;3.&amp;nbsp; Access the REST directory and make note of the url for the tables&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;4.&amp;nbsp; Share the content on AGOL&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;5.&amp;nbsp; Open a new or existing operation view&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;6.&amp;nbsp; Add an external data source and browse to the table shared in step 4&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;7.&amp;nbsp; Configure widgets using new data source&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If you have issues with this please post back so we can learn together.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Brandon&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
